Librarian


Dear librarian
Do you Laugh
Do you bleed
i know you at least read

why do you seem so mad to me
is this not, librarian, where you want to be

tell me of your ambitions
tell me of your dreams

librarian, are you a libertarian?
You look like a shaggy liberal
but you act like a staunch conservative

dear librarian i am not much of a poet
i can't spell so good either
buit i'm bored, i saw you
librarian, i'd like to communicate

a lot of people judge you
and that certainly isn't fair
you are not a dragon
this is not your laire

Do you listen to Warren Zevon
or a drummer named Levon?

would you judge my misspelling
or would you smile and not care?

where do you go when you go home
and what would you rather be doing?
